Summary

Lincoln Elementary is a public school serving about 230 students in grades 2 through 5 in the Hoquiam School District, a district that faces significant challenges across all its schools.

The school serves a community with high economic need, and its overall test scores in reading and math are below the state average. However, Lincoln has notable strengths, particularly in science, where its scores are much closer to the state average and are a bright spot compared to other local schools like Central Elementary and Stevens Elementary School. The school also spends more per student than many nearby schools, which may reflect additional support services for its students.

When compared to other schools in the area, Lincoln typically performs better than others within the Hoquiam School District, such as Central Elementary, but lags behind some schools in neighboring districts like higher-performing Simpson Avenue Elementary in Montesano. A key trend for parents to note is that the school's statewide ranking has declined in recent years, a pattern seen in several local schools, indicating broader regional educational challenges.
